FujiFilm F70EXR vs Nikon S1000pj Physical Comparison

If you are aiming to travel with your camera frequently, you need to take into account its weight and measurements. The FujiFilm F70EXR comes with exterior dimensions of 99mm x 59mm x 23mm (3.9" x 2.3" x 0.9") and a weight of 205 grams (0.45 lbs) whilst the Nikon S1000pj has proportions of 96mm x 62mm x 23mm (3.8" x 2.4" x 0.9") accompanied by a weight of 175 grams (0.39 lbs).

FujiFilm F70EXR vs Nikon S1000pj Sensor Comparison

Usually, it is very hard to envision the contrast between sensor dimensions simply by looking at a spec sheet. The image underneath will help give you a clearer sense of the sensor sizes in the F70EXR and S1000pj.

As you can see, the two cameras have got different megapixels and different sensor dimensions. The F70EXR because of its bigger sensor will make shooting shallower depth of field easier and the Nikon S1000pj will resolve extra detail utilizing its extra 2 Megapixels. Higher resolution will let you crop pictures much more aggressively.
